How Sensi Products Made the Transition from Medicinal to Recreational Cannabis
Sensi Products recently underwent a complete redesign to make the transition to solely medical marijuana edibles to consumer products for recreational use. The company's co-founder Lisa Tollner explains how her company made this switch, and her outlook for this expanding market in California.
"For the most part it was a pretty straight forward maneuver for us," explains Tollner. "We saw this coming. I would say as early as five or six years ago we felt it was just a matter of time."
Tollner says the procedures and paperwork for regulation in this evolving market can be intimidating for those new to this space. "It's not easy, and so the transition to this new format takes a lot of people time," says Tollner. "A lot of it is no different than a typical business but it does have added layers."
